Yankees hoping it’s Holliday time...Even with a series of trades designed to infuse the team with youth, the Yankees occasionally sign an aging veteran to fill a need. Next up, Matt Holliday (DH, NYY), who signed a one-year deal as a free agent. While Holliday qualifies as an OF going into 2017 drafts, he’s expected to spend most of his time at DH.

Year   AB   BA    xBA  bb%  ct%  h%    G/L/F   HctX  HR   PX  xPX  hr/f
====  ===  ====  ====  ===  ===  ==  ========  ====  ==  ===  ===  ====
2012  599  .295  .270   11   78  34  46/19/35   135  27  132  145   16%
2013  519  .299  .286   12   83  32  46/21/34   133  22  121  126   15%
2014  574  .272  .268   11   83  30  46/17/38   140  20  119  142   11%
